Swimming Attire and Equipment
• Parents and helpers attending the Infant Aquatic Programme must wear appropriate swim wear. Please do not wear T-shirts
or underwear.
• For Beginner 1 lessons upwards it is essential for children to wear a good pair of goggles.
• For Beginner 4 lessons upwards all swimmers need to purchase a pair of fins.
